- Murphy’s thesis: Senator Murphy argues Trump has turned the White House into a round-the-clock corruption and self-enrichment operation, betting the public will grow numb if scandals come fast enough — and that he wants to document “500 days of corruption” before it becomes normalized.
Crypto enforcement gutted (April 2025)
- Acting AG Todd Blanche orders termination of Biden-era DOJ crypto investigations.
- Blanche is himself a major crypto investor, working for a president deeply invested in crypto.
- He also eliminates the entire DOJ team policing crypto fraud and money laundering.
Pay-to-play favors for donors
- Poultry giant Pilgrim’s Pride donated $5M to Trump’s inauguration, then got the salmonella-limit rule reversed.
- Nursing home executives paid for a private lunch, asked Trump to kill a staffing rule, and he ordered it done immediately.
- Big Tobacco donated $5M, got a lunch, and within a week the FDA reversed flavored-vape rules (the FDA commissioner resigned in protest).
- A bridge owner donated $1M, met Commerce Secretary Lutnik, and within hours Trump blocked a competing Detroit-Canada bridge.
Pardons for cash
- Paul Walczak: his mother paid $1M for a meeting; weeks later he got a full pardon erasing $4.4M he stole from employees.
- Changpeng Zhao: jailed for enabling terrorist/criminal financing, pardoned after helping launch Trump’s crypto business.
- Joseph Schwarz: nursing-home fraudster freed after paying $1M to Trump-connected lobbyists.
- April 10th: Trump publicly promised to “pardon everyone within 200 ft of the White House.”
Insider deals enriching Trump’s circle and family
- Stephen Miller held Palantir stock; ICE then gave Palantir a $30M no-bid surveillance contract.
- Donald Trump Jr. invested in Vulcan Elements; the Pentagon (reluctantly) gave it a $620M loan and stake, 10x-ing its value.
- Trump Jr. also profited from a DOJ move declaring a century-old mail-order-handgun ban unconstitutional.
Self-dealing by Trump himself
- Earned $57M selling crypto tokens to entities tied to North Korea, Iran, and Russia.
- Ordered Coast Guard facilities to stock his branded wine and cider.
- Awarded a $17M no-bid fountain contract (estimated true cost ~$3M) to a friend.
- Personally signed off on thousands of stock trades (e.g., bought Dell stock, publicly boosted it, then gave Dell a $10B defense contract).
Other schemes
- Corey Lewandowski allegedly ran mob-style extortion, demanding payments to protect DHS contracts.
- Investors likely with inside info bet ~$950M on falling oil prices hours before Trump’s Iran ceasefire announcement.
- Transportation Secretary Sean Duffy’s family road-trip show was bankrolled by companies (Toyota, Boeing, United) he regulates.
- Closing warning: Murphy frames these not as isolated scandals but a system, cautioning that once corruption becomes normal it becomes permanent — and calls on both parties and the public to treat it as the crisis it is.
